            “stereotype” means “a solid copy” - as in a mold, plate or cast. The metaphor being that everyone who does or is XYZ came from the same manufacturing process and therefore is the same.

            There is no stereotype of being clean shaven because you can’t say “all people who shave are XYZ” and have it make sense.
